As a general remark as I get quite some questions if and when a
scanner will be supported by the SANE project: If it is a new scanner
and not compatible/similar to a scanner that's already supported it's
quite unlikely that "someone of the SANE project" will start writing a
driver. Usually it's up to one of the owners of such a scanner to
write the driver. He'll get help from us and the driver can be
included into SANE. But the hard work must be done by one of the
owners of this scanner.
